Understanding the Risks of Content Leaks
Content leaks can occur due to various reasons, including hacking, password breaches, or intentional sharing by subscribers. When Dare Taylor’s Onlyfans content is leaked, it can lead to a range of negative consequences, including financial losses, damage to their reputation, and emotional distress. Leaked content can also be shared on other platforms, making it difficult for the creator to control its distribution and potentially leading to further exploitation.
Financial Consequences of Leaks
One of the most significant financial consequences of content leaks is the loss of revenue. When exclusive content is leaked, subscribers may no longer see the need to pay for access, leading to a decline in income for the creator. Additionally, leaked content can also lead to a loss of potential subscribers, as they may be able to access the content for free elsewhere. Staying Safe in the Digital Age
To stay safe in the digital age, creators can take several steps to protect their content and their online presence. These include using strong passwords, enabling two-factor authentication, and regularly monitoring their accounts for suspicious activity. Creators can also consider using VPN (Virtual Private Network) services to protect their online activity and prevent hacking.
- Use strong, unique passwords for all accounts
- Enable two-factor authentication for added security
- Regularly monitor accounts for suspicious activity
- Use VPN services to protect online activity
- Consider using DRM tools to protect content
